A part of the "tri-cities" of South Western Ontario, Waterloo is located 100 km west of Toronto. Look for an apartment to rent in Waterloo if you love being part of a smaller, but active community. With acres of parkland and great shopping, you'll find everything you need in Waterloo.
Sports, Parks and Recreation in Waterloo
• RIM Park – This premier recreation facility and park is sure to attract people who want to find an apartment for rent in Waterloo. Besides hosting a variety of arts, cultural and other events, RIM Park features outdoor sports fields, a multi-purpose recreational facility, trails and a golf course.
• Waterloo Park – The "Jewel of the City" hosts a variety of events throughout the year and is the perfect place to get out and enjoy the outdoors.
Arts, Culture and Attractions in Waterloo
• Kitchener/Waterloo Oktoberfest – This world-class event is the largest Oktoberfest outside of Germany and is looked forward to all year by residents and all those who volunteer to make this event possible.
• Waterloo Festival for Animated Cinema – This annual festival celebrates the power of storytelling in a full-length, animated feature film.
• Waterloo Buskers Carnival – This vibrant festival, which takes place in uptown Waterloo, is a fun event for the whole family.
• Canadian Clay and Glass Gallery – This gallery features exhibits by both Canadian and International artists. This facility is great for residents as they offer award-winning exhibits, that change throughout the year, as well as classes and programs to help develop skill and appreciation for the craft of art and design.
Post-Secondary Education in Waterloo
Students can find studio or one bedroom apartments to rent near colleges or universities in Waterloo.
• University of Waterloo – This university is reputed for its engineering and math programs and is located near Waterloo Park.
• Conestoga College – This excellent college is known for its trade skills and culinary arts programs and has a main campus in Kitchener, with additional campuses in surrounding areas, including Waterloo.
• Wilfred Laurier University – This University is reputed for its business and liberal arts programs and the main campus is located in Waterloo.
Public Transportation in Waterloo
• Grand River Transit – This transit system operates in Waterloo, Kitchener and Cambridge.
• GO Transit – Commuters can make daily trips to and from Toronto using the GO service.
